- The distance between Ouagadougou, Burkina Faso and Kumejima, Japan is approximately 12,967 km or 8,058 mi.
- To reach Ouagadougou in this distance one would set out from Kumejima bearing 301°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Ouagadougou bearing 231.9° or SW .
- Ouagadougou has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Kumejima has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- The annual average temperature is 6.4 °C (11.4°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 4.5 °C (8.1°F) less in Ouagadougou.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1279.6 mm (50.4 in) less which is equivalent to 1279.6 l/m² (31.4 US gal/ft²) or 12,796,000 l/ha (1,367,977 US gal/ac) less. About 2/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 9.2° higher in Ouagadougou than in Kumejima.
- Relative humidity levels are 38.3%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 6.3°C (11.3°F) lower.
